INFLUENCE OF FIBER COATING ON TENSILE BEHAVIOR OF UNIDIRECTIONAL C/Mg COMPOSITESKeywords: tensile properties,C/Mg composite,fiber coating Abstract: The mechanical properties and deformation mechanisms of unidirectional carbon fiber reiopreed magnesium composites under tensile loading are studied. Two different materials are used as fiber coatings: a single silica and a gradient C/SiC/SiO2. The results show that, under the same preparation conditions, composite with the former coating is broken in a non-cumulative mode and its failure stress is rather low. Conversely, the latter coating demonstrates much better efficiency and the cormsponding composite is broken in a cumttlative mode.
